What Is A Ct Workstation (3d/reporting)?

A CT Workstation (3D/Reporting) is a specialized computer system designed to process, visualize, and interpret complex medical imaging data generated by Computed Tomography (CT) scanners. Beyond basic image viewing, these workstations employ advanced software to reconstruct CT data into three-dimensional (3D) models, enabling a more intuitive and detailed understanding of anatomical structures and pathologies. This powerful platform is crucial for radiologists and clinicians in Equatorial Guinea to perform in-depth analysis, generate comprehensive reports, and facilitate precise diagnosis and treatment planning.

  • Advanced Image Processing: Reconstructs 2D CT slices into high-resolution 3D renderings, allowing for multiplanar reformations (MPR), maximum intensity projections (MIP), and volume rendering (VR) to visualize complex anatomy and pathology from any angle.
  • Enhanced Diagnostic Capabilities: Facilitates detailed examination of intricate anatomical relationships, the extent of disease, and subtle abnormalities that might be missed on conventional 2D views, improving diagnostic accuracy.
  • Streamlined Reporting Workflow: Integrates image analysis with intuitive reporting tools, enabling clinicians to document findings efficiently, annotate images, and generate high-quality reports for referring physicians.
  • Key Clinical Applications: Essential for diagnosing and managing a wide range of conditions, including oncological staging and treatment monitoring, vascular imaging (e.g., identifying aneurysms or stenosis), orthopedic assessments (e.g., complex fractures), neurological evaluations (e.g., stroke assessment, tumor localization), and pre-surgical planning for complex procedures.

Calibration Requirements

Accurate image interpretation is paramount. Therefore, precise calibration is a mandatory part of the installation process:

  • Monitor Calibration: Using specialized calibration tools, our technicians will ensure the monitors meet DICOM Part 14 standards for luminance and grayscale. This guarantees accurate display of medical images, essential for reliable diagnoses.
  • Software Calibration: The reporting software will be calibrated to your specific workflows and reporting templates, ensuring efficient and standardized report generation.
  • Image Quality Assurance: We will perform test scans and image quality assessments to confirm the workstation is producing and displaying images with the expected fidelity.

How Much Is A Ct Workstation (3d/reporting) In Equatorial Guinea?

Determining the exact cost of a CT Workstation with 3D and reporting capabilities in Equatorial Guinea requires a comprehensive assessment of specific needs, vendor options, and current market dynamics. However, we can provide a realistic, albeit broad, price range in the local currency, the Central African CFA franc (XAF).

Factors influencing the price include the workstation's processing power, the sophistication of the 3D rendering software, the advanced analytics and AI features integrated, the chosen PACS (Picture Archiving and Communication System) compatibility, the inclusion of specialized reporting tools, and the level of vendor support and training provided. Furthermore, import duties, shipping costs, and installation services specific to Equatorial Guinea will add to the final price.

For a functional CT Workstation capable of 3D reconstruction and detailed reporting, businesses in Equatorial Guinea can generally expect an investment ranging from approximately 15,000,000 XAF to 45,000,000 XAF. This range caters to different tiers of solutions, from robust entry-level configurations to high-performance systems equipped with cutting-edge technologies.

For advanced, enterprise-grade solutions featuring powerful GPU acceleration for complex 3D visualizations, integrated AI-driven diagnostic assistance, and highly specialized reporting modules, the investment could extend beyond this range, potentially reaching 50,000,000 XAF and above. It is crucial to obtain detailed quotes from multiple reputable suppliers to ascertain the most accurate pricing for your specific requirements.

  • Entry-level to mid-range CT Workstations (3D/Reporting): 15,000,000 XAF - 30,000,000 XAF
  • High-performance CT Workstations (Advanced 3D/Comprehensive Reporting): 30,000,000 XAF - 45,000,000 XAF
  • Enterprise-grade/Premium CT Workstations (AI-integrated, Top-tier Visualization): 45,000,000 XAF and upwards
